Output 3c2c90310787a9c03c789a540f5febdb0a603d66bc68c04c35f725227ef1c204:1

value
149909
script pubkey
OP_0 OP_PUSHBYTES_20 6e0d904eeb4c53b3cfbe82375abae12b1e151b72
address
bc1qdcxeqnhtf3fm8na7sgm44whp9v0p2xmjclslu9
transaction
3c2c90310787a9c03c789a540f5febdb0a603d66bc68c04c35f725227ef1c204
confirmations
40296
spent
true